Při své práci používám pro stylování dokumentů pro mě nejlepší software na trhu TopStyle. V nedávné době jsem narazil na problém s BOM (Byte Order Mark).
Upgradovali jsme stránky klienta, vše v pořádku. Najednou si klient vzpomněl, že chce drobnou grafickou úpravu, ok, provedeme. Oprava zabrala pár minut, soubor jsme nahráli na server, ale stránky byly rozhozené. Co s tím, co to je? Chvíli trvalo, než jsme na to přišli. Na vině byly právě zmíněné znaky na začátku souboru – BOM neboli Byte Order Mark. Program na začátek souboru vložil neviditelné znaky, které říkají v jakém kódování je zmíněný dokument.
Trošku jsem pátral v nastavení a našli jsme tam položku, která tohle všechno způsobila. Pokud máte podobný problém, stačí odznačit (viz obrázek) a je hotovo.
Napsat komentář